The Metabolic Rate: A Quick Overview
Metabolism is the sum of all chemical processes that occur in your body to keep you alive and functioning. It's the engine that converts food and drinks into energy. The speed at which your body burns calories is known as your metabolic rate. This rate varies from person to person and is influenced by factors such as age, sex, genetics, body composition, and activity level.
As we age, several factors contribute to a gradual decline in metabolic rate. While it might seem like an unavoidable fate, understanding these factors empowers us to make informed choices about our health and lifestyle.
Key Factors Contributing to a Slower Metabolism
Several interconnected factors lead to a metabolic slowdown as we get older. Addressing these factors proactively can help mitigate the effects of aging on your metabolism.
1. Muscle Mass Decline (Sarcopenia)
One of the most significant contributors to a slower metabolism is the age-related loss of muscle mass, known as sarcopenia. Muscle tissue is more metabolically active than fat tissue, meaning it burns more calories at rest. As we age, we naturally start to lose muscle mass, typically beginning in our 30s and accelerating after age 60. This decline reduces our resting metabolic rate (RMR), the number of calories our body burns at rest.
Resistance training and adequate protein intake can help combat sarcopenia. Building and maintaining muscle mass is crucial for maintaining a healthy metabolic rate throughout life. Consider incorporating weightlifting, bodyweight exercises, or resistance band workouts into your routine.
2. Hormonal Changes
Hormonal fluctuations are another significant factor influencing metabolism. These changes can impact both men and women, though the specific hormones involved may differ.
For Women: Menopause and Estrogen Decline
During menopause, women experience a significant drop in estrogen levels. Estrogen plays a role in regulating metabolism, and its decline can lead to decreased RMR and an increased tendency to store fat, particularly around the abdominal area. This hormonal shift can also affect insulin sensitivity, making it harder to regulate blood sugar levels.
Hormone replacement therapy (HRT) can sometimes alleviate some of these metabolic effects, but it’s essential to discuss the risks and benefits with a healthcare provider. Lifestyle adjustments, such as a balanced diet and regular exercise, are crucial for managing menopausal metabolic changes.
For Men: Testosterone Decline
Men experience a gradual decline in testosterone levels as they age, starting around age 30. Testosterone is vital for maintaining muscle mass and a healthy metabolism. Lower testosterone levels can contribute to decreased muscle mass, increased body fat, and a slower metabolic rate.
Maintaining a healthy lifestyle, including regular exercise and a balanced diet, can help support testosterone levels. In some cases, testosterone replacement therapy (TRT) may be considered, but it’s crucial to weigh the potential risks and benefits with a healthcare professional.
3. Reduced Physical Activity
As we age, many people become less physically active. This could be due to joint pain, decreased energy levels, or simply a change in lifestyle habits. Reduced physical activity not only contributes to muscle loss but also lowers the overall energy expenditure, further slowing down metabolism.
Incorporating regular physical activity into your daily routine is essential for maintaining a healthy metabolism. Aim for a mix of aerobic exercise (such as walking, swimming, or cycling) and strength training to burn calories and build muscle mass.
4. Genetics and Predisposition
Genetics play a role in determining your metabolic rate. Some people are genetically predisposed to have a faster or slower metabolism. While you can't change your genes, understanding your genetic predispositions can help you tailor your lifestyle choices to better manage your metabolism. If you have a family history of weight gain or metabolic issues, it may be even more important to focus on diet and exercise.
5. Thyroid Function
The thyroid gland produces hormones that regulate metabolism. As we age, the risk of thyroid dysfunction, particularly hypothyroidism (underactive thyroid), increases. Hypothyroidism can significantly slow down metabolism, leading to weight gain, fatigue, and other symptoms.
Regular thyroid screenings can help detect and manage thyroid issues. If you experience symptoms such as unexplained weight gain, fatigue, or sensitivity to cold, consult your doctor to check your thyroid function.
6. Stress and Sleep Deprivation
Chronic stress and lack of sleep can disrupt hormonal balance and negatively impact metabolism. Stress hormones like cortisol can promote fat storage, especially in the abdominal area. Sleep deprivation can also affect hormones that regulate appetite and metabolism, leading to increased cravings and weight gain.
Prioritizing stress management techniques, such as meditation, yoga, or spending time in nature, and ensuring adequate sleep (7-9 hours per night) can help support a healthy metabolism.

Strategies to Boost Your Metabolism as You Age
While some age-related metabolic changes are inevitable, there are several strategies you can implement to counteract these effects and maintain a healthy metabolism.
1. Strength Training
As previously mentioned, building and maintaining muscle mass is crucial for a healthy metabolism. Strength training helps combat sarcopenia and increases your resting metabolic rate. Aim for at least two to three strength training sessions per week, focusing on major muscle groups such as legs, back, chest, and arms.
2. High-Intensity Interval Training (HIIT)
HIIT involves short bursts of intense exercise followed by brief recovery periods. This type of training has been shown to be highly effective at burning calories and boosting metabolism, even after the workout is over. HIIT can be incorporated into various activities, such as running, cycling, or bodyweight exercises. [externalLink insert]
3. Eat a Balanced Diet
A well-balanced diet is essential for maintaining a healthy metabolism. Focus on consuming whole, unprocessed foods, including lean protein, complex carbohydrates, healthy fats, and plenty of fruits and vegetables.
**Protein:Adequate protein intake is crucial for building and repairing muscle tissue. Aim for at least 0.8 grams of protein per kilogram of body weight per day.
**Complex Carbohydrates:Choose complex carbohydrates, such as whole grains, over simple sugars and processed foods. Complex carbohydrates provide sustained energy and help regulate blood sugar levels.
**Healthy Fats:Include healthy fats, such as those found in avocados, nuts, seeds, and olive oil, in your diet. Healthy fats are important for hormone production and overall health.
**Fruits and Vegetables:These are rich in vitamins, minerals, and antioxidants, which support overall health and metabolism.
4. Stay Hydrated
Drinking enough water is essential for all bodily functions, including metabolism. Water helps transport nutrients and remove waste products, and it can also help you feel full, which can aid in weight management. Aim for at least eight glasses of water per day.
5. Get Enough Sleep
Prioritize getting 7-9 hours of quality sleep each night. Sleep deprivation can disrupt hormones that regulate appetite and metabolism, leading to increased cravings and weight gain.
6. Manage Stress
Chronic stress can negatively impact metabolism. Incorporate stress management techniques into your daily routine, such as meditation, yoga, deep breathing exercises, or spending time in nature.

Debunking Metabolism Myths
Several myths surround metabolism, and it's important to separate fact from fiction.
**Myth:You can drastically change your metabolism overnight.
**Reality:Metabolism is a complex process that changes gradually over time. Quick fixes and fad diets are often unsustainable and can even be harmful.
**Myth:Eating late at night causes weight gain.
**Reality:It's not the timing of your meals but the total number of calories you consume that matters. Eating a large, calorie-dense meal at any time of day can lead to weight gain.
**Myth:Only young people can have a fast metabolism.
**Reality:While metabolism naturally slows down with age, you can still maintain a healthy metabolism through lifestyle choices such as diet and exercise.
